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
444448038 33085 3197138788 74596 2141
181833524 52200811207 01924985
181833524 52200811207 01924985
7148232323 346800810 81015207 128222
All about undefined
Interested in learning more?
181833524 52200811207 01924985
7148232323 346800810 81015207 128222
See more
21940 04056 46975722
342 4423479124 30 488553 46412806
See more
3358 64680168427
31 64 822536
See more